Saints March Past Madonna in Homecoming Blowout

ADRIAN, Mich. -- The Siena Heights football team jumped out to a quick 28-0 lead in the first quarter and never looked back in a 71-6 blowout win over Madonna during the 2021 SHU Homecoming game. The Saints (3-3, 2-2) get back to .500 with the win.

Ethan LoPresto had a big day with 153 rushing yards (10.9 AVG) and a touchdown. His rushing totals, including a 57-yard touchdown run in the second quarter, pushed the score to 42-0. Five other Saints scored rushing touchdowns. Jared Jordan scored twice on the ground. Kaleb Jefferson, Andre Chenault, Quincy Johnson Jr., and Eric Williams II scored a rushing touchdown. Williams II also had a receiving touchdown. Anthony Secchi scored nine points on 9/10 extra-point attempts.

Kole Murlin led the defense with 11 tackles, a sack, two tackles for loss, and three pass breakups. Gabe Callery and Jalen Williams each had two interceptions. The Saints' defense smothered the Crusader offense with eight sacks on the afternoon. 

SHU capped the first two drives with rushing touchdowns to take a quick 14-0 lead. Williams then picked off a pass from Josh DePaulis and returned it 37 yards for a score and a 21-0 lead. Jordan scored the second of his touchdown runs on the next Siena Heights drive, and the Saints were ahead 28-0 before the close of the first quarter. 

Williams II put the ball into the endzone on a five-yard run in the first 32 seconds of the second quarter to push the Saints' lead to 35. LoPresto then hit his 57-yard touchdown scamper with 11:54 remaining in the half.  A blocked punt by Daneille Lowe Jr. gave SHU the 48-0 lead with 10:47 on the clock. Williams II caught a 46-yard touchdown pass from Ryan Minor for the final score of the half as the Saints took a 55-0 lead into the locker room.

In the third quarter, the Crusaders got on the board when Jesse Morris blocked a punt, and it was recovered in the endzone for six points. Two points were added to the Saint lead after a safety, and the lead was at 51 points (57-6) with 14:03 left in regulation. Chenault added to the blowout with a two-yard run with 9:19 left on the clock. Johnson Jr. finished the scoring for the Homecoming game with a 14-yard run with 2:01 left to play.
